tubes profilés, or profiled tubes, are an essential component in many industries, offering a versatile solution for a wide range of applications. These tubes are crafted from various materials such as steel, aluminum, and stainless steel, and are known for their strength, durability, and flexibility. As such, they are widely used in construction, manufacturing, automotive, and other sectors where reliable and efficient structures are required.
One of the key advantages of tubes profilés is their versatility in design and application. These tubes can be customized to meet specific requirements, allowing for the creation of complex structures with precise dimensions. This flexibility makes them ideal for a variety of projects, from simple support beams to intricate architectural designs.
In the construction industry, tubes profilés are commonly used for creating frameworks for buildings, bridges, and other structures. Their high strength-to-weight ratio makes them an excellent choice for supporting heavy loads and withstanding extreme conditions. In addition, the ability to customize the shape and size of profiled tubes allows architects and engineers to create unique and innovative designs that meet both aesthetic and functional requirements.
In the manufacturing sector, profiled tubes play a crucial role in the production of machinery and equipment. These tubes are often used to create conveyor systems, support structures, and other components that require precision engineering and robust construction. By using profiled tubes, manufacturers can ensure the reliability and durability of their products, leading to improved efficiency and safety in the workplace.
The automotive industry is another key market for tubes profilés, where they are used in the production of vehicles, including cars, trucks, and buses. Profiled tubes are commonly employed in chassis construction, providing the necessary strength and rigidity to support the vehicle’s frame and body. Additionally, these tubes are used in exhaust systems, roll cages, and other critical components that require high performance and durability.
Beyond these industries, tubes profilés are also utilized in a variety of other applications, such as furniture manufacturing, agricultural machinery, and aerospace technology. Their versatility and reliability make them an indispensable part of modern engineering and design, allowing for the creation of innovative solutions to complex challenges.
When choosing profiled tubes for a project, it is essential to consider factors such as material, size, shape, and finish. Different materials offer varying levels of strength, corrosion resistance, and thermal conductivity, so selecting the right material for the job is critical to ensuring the success of the project. Additionally, the size and shape of the tubes will determine their structural integrity and load-bearing capacity, so careful consideration must be given to these factors during the design and fabrication process.
In terms of finish, profiled tubes can be coated or treated to enhance their performance and appearance. Common finishes include galvanization, powder coating, and anodizing, which provide protection against corrosion, abrasion, and other environmental factors. By choosing the appropriate finish for the application, engineers and designers can extend the lifespan of the tubes and maintain their aesthetic appeal over time.
